    Can the iPhone 11 Use an eSIM?

    First things first, can your iPhone 11 actually use an eSIM? The short answer is a resounding YES! Apple started rolling out eSIM support with the iPhone XR, XS, and XS Max, and the iPhone 11 series continued that trend. This means your iPhone 11 is fully equipped to handle the digital magic of an eSIM. No physical SIM card needed, just a quick digital download and you're good to go. It's a pretty sweet upgrade from fumbling with tiny SIM trays, don't you think? eSIMs offer a ton of flexibility, especially if you're a frequent traveler or someone who likes to switch carriers without the hassle. You can have multiple eSIM profiles stored on your device, allowing you to easily switch between your personal and work numbers, or activate a local data plan when you're abroad.     What is an eSIM?

    Before we get too deep into the Airalo part, let's quickly chat about what an eSIM actually is. Think of it as a digital SIM card. Instead of a tiny piece of plastic you pop into your phone, an eSIM is a small chip embedded directly into your device's hardware. This chip can be programmed remotely by your carrier. What this means for you is a much more streamlined experience. You can activate a cellular plan without needing to get a physical SIM card. The whole process is done digitally, usually by scanning a QR code or entering a code provided by your carrier or eSIM provider. This technology is changing the game for how we connect to cellular networks. It's more secure, more convenient, and opens up a world of possibilities for managing your mobile plans. For instance, with an eSIM, you can easily switch between different providers or plans without having to physically swap SIM cards. This is particularly handy if you travel frequently and need to switch to local data plans in different countries. It also allows for dual-SIM functionality on newer phones, meaning you can have both a personal and a work number, or a primary SIM and a travel eSIM, all active on the same device. The embedded nature of the eSIM also means manufacturers can potentially save space within the device, allowing for sleeker designs or more room for other components like bigger batteries.     How Airalo Works with Your iPhone 11 eSIM

    Now, let's talk about Airalo. Airalo is a fantastic platform that specializes in providing eSIM data plans for travelers and anyone needing affordable connectivity. They partner with local network operators worldwide to offer a huge variety of data packages. So, how does it all come together with your iPhone 11? It's super straightforward, guys! You download the Airalo app, create an account, and then you can browse and purchase eSIM data plans based on your destination and data needs. Once you've bought a plan, Airalo will guide you through the installation process. For your iPhone 11, this usually involves going into your iPhone's Settings, then Cellular, and selecting 'Add eSIM'. You'll then follow the prompts, which might include scanning a QR code provided by Airalo or manually entering details. After the eSIM profile is installed, you can activate it and start using your data plan.     Potential Downsides and How to Mitigate Them

    While the Airalo eSIM experience on the iPhone 11 is generally fantastic, it's always good to be aware of potential bumps in the road, right? Let's talk about a few things and how you can easily navigate them.

    • Data Only: Most Airalo plans are data-only. This means they are primarily for internet access. While you can often use messaging apps like WhatsApp or Telegram for calls and texts over data, you won't be able to make traditional voice calls or send SMS messages using the Airalo eSIM number itself. Mitigation: Ensure your primary SIM or eSIM is still active for calls and texts, or rely on Wi-Fi calling features and VoIP apps when data is available. You can also check if your home carrier offers a cost-effective international calling plan if you anticipate needing traditional calls.
    • Coverage Gaps: Although Airalo boasts extensive coverage, there might be specific remote areas or certain countries where their partner networks don't offer the best signal strength or availability. Mitigation: Before you travel, check the Airalo app or website for specific coverage details in your destination. Look at user reviews if available. Sometimes, choosing a regional plan might offer better network options than a country-specific one, or vice versa, depending on your exact location within a country. Don't hesitate to reach out to Airalo support if you have specific concerns about coverage in an off-the-beaten-path location.
    • Activation Issues: Very rarely, users might encounter minor glitches during the eSIM installation or activation process. This is usually due to network hiccups or a slight delay in the system. Mitigation: Ensure you have a stable Wi-Fi connection when installing the eSIM. If activation seems stuck, try restarting your iPhone. Most importantly, contact Airalo customer support – they are generally very responsive and can help troubleshoot the issue quickly. Having a backup plan, like accessing Wi-Fi at your hotel or airport, is always a good idea while you're getting set up.
    • Data Speed Variations: Just like any mobile network, data speeds can vary depending on the location, network congestion, and the specific partner network Airalo is using in that area. You might not always get blazing-fast 5G speeds everywhere. Mitigation: Check the plan details for expected speeds. Understand that speeds can fluctuate. If consistent high speed is absolutely critical for your trip, research local network performance in your destination beforehand. For most users, however, the speeds provided are more than adequate for browsing, social media, and navigation.
    • Choosing the Right Plan: With so many options, selecting the perfect plan can sometimes feel a bit overwhelming. Mitigation: Carefully assess your expected data usage. Think about how much data you used on previous trips. Check if your accommodation provides Wi-Fi. Airalo offers plans with different data amounts and validity periods, so you can find a balance that fits your budget and needs. Start with a smaller plan if you're unsure, and you can always top it up.

    Setting Up Airalo eSIM on iPhone 11: Step-by-Step

    Alright, let's get practical. You've decided to go with Airalo for your iPhone 11 eSIM needs. Awesome choice! Here’s a super easy, step-by-step walkthrough to get you connected. You'll want to do this when you have a stable Wi-Fi connection, either before you travel or once you've arrived and found some Wi-Fi.

    1. Download the Airalo App: First things first, head over to the App Store on your iPhone 11 and download the Airalo app. It's free!
    2. Create an Account: Open the app and sign up for an account. You'll need an email address and to create a password. You might also get a referral code from a friend – using one can sometimes get you a discount on your first purchase!
    3. Choose Your eSIM Plan: Once logged in, tap on 'Buy eSIM'. You can then search for your destination. Type in the country you're going to, or select a regional or global plan if that suits you better. Browse through the available plans – they’ll show you the data amount, validity period (how long the data lasts), and the price. Pick the one that best fits your needs and budget.
    4. Purchase the eSIM: After selecting your plan, proceed to checkout. You can usually pay using a credit/debit card, PayPal, or other payment methods depending on your region. Complete the payment process.
    5. Install the eSIM: This is the crucial part. Once your purchase is complete, Airalo will prompt you to install the eSIM. Tap on 'Install eSIM'. Your iPhone 11 will then guide you through the process. You'll likely see an option like 'Add Cellular Plan' or 'Add eSIM'. Follow the on-screen instructions.
      • Manual Entry vs. QR Code: Airalo usually provides both options. Scanning a QR code is often the quickest. If you can't scan it (e.g., you're viewing on the same device), you might need to manually enter the details provided by Airalo, which involves copying and pasting specific codes into the relevant fields in your iPhone's settings.
    6. Label Your eSIM: After installation, your iPhone will ask you to label the new cellular plan. It's a good idea to label it something clear, like 'Airalo Data' or 'Travel eSIM'. This helps you distinguish it from your primary SIM/eSIM, especially when managing data usage.
    7. Activate the eSIM: Go to Settings > Cellular (or Settings > Mobile Data on some devices). You should see your newly added Airalo eSIM listed. Tap on it. You'll need to toggle the 'Turn On This Line' option to activate it. Make sure 'Data Roaming' is turned ON for this line – this is essential for the eSIM to work abroad. Important Note: Ensure that 'Default Voice Line' is set to your primary SIM/eSIM if you don't want your calls to go through the Airalo plan. You can set 'Cellular Data' to use the Airalo eSIM.
    8. Connect to the Network: Once activated, your iPhone 11 should connect to the local network supported by your Airalo plan. You might see a different network name appear in your status bar. Open your browser or an app like Airalo to confirm you have internet access.
    9. Monitor Your Data Usage: Keep an eye on your data consumption through the Airalo app. It shows you how much data you've used and how much you have left, along with the expiry date.
